Enum ColorTransfer 

Source
#[non_exhaustive]
pub enum ColorTransfer { Bt709, Bt2020_10, Bt2020_12, Hlg, Pq, Linear, Unknown, }
Expand description

Color transfer characteristic (opto-electronic transfer function).

The transfer characteristic defines how scene luminance maps to the signal level stored in the video bitstream. Different HDR and SDR standards use different curves.

§Common Usage

  • Bt709: Standard SDR video (HD television)
  • Pq: HDR10 and Dolby Vision (SMPTE ST 2084 / Perceptual Quantizer)
  • Hlg: Hybrid Log-Gamma — broadcast-compatible HDR (ARIB STD-B67)
  • Bt2020_10 / Bt2020_12: BT.2020 SDR at 10/12-bit depth
  • Linear: Linear light, no gamma applied

Variants (Non-exhaustive)§

This enum is marked as non-exhaustive
Non-exhaustive enums could have additional variants added in future. Therefore, when matching against variants of non-exhaustive enums, an extra wildcard arm must be added to account for any future variants.
§

Bt709

ITU-R BT.709 transfer characteristic (standard SDR)

§

Bt2020_10

ITU-R BT.2020 for 10-bit content

§

Bt2020_12

ITU-R BT.2020 for 12-bit content

§

Hlg

Hybrid Log-Gamma (ARIB STD-B67) — broadcast HDR

§

Pq

Perceptual Quantizer / SMPTE ST 2084 — HDR10

§

Linear

Linear light transfer (no gamma)

§

Unknown

Transfer characteristic is not specified or unknown

Implementations§

Source§

impl ColorTransfer

Source

pub const fn name(&self) -> &'static str

Returns the name of the color transfer characteristic as a string.

§Examples
use ff_format::color::ColorTransfer;

assert_eq!(ColorTransfer::Bt709.name(), "bt709");
assert_eq!(ColorTransfer::Hlg.name(), "hlg");
assert_eq!(ColorTransfer::Pq.name(), "pq");
Source

pub const fn is_hdr(&self) -> bool

Returns true if this is an HDR transfer characteristic (Pq or Hlg).

§Examples
use ff_format::color::ColorTransfer;

assert!(ColorTransfer::Pq.is_hdr());
assert!(ColorTransfer::Hlg.is_hdr());
assert!(!ColorTransfer::Bt709.is_hdr());
Source

pub const fn is_hlg(&self) -> bool

Returns true if this is Hybrid Log-Gamma (HLG).

§Examples
use ff_format::color::ColorTransfer;

assert!(ColorTransfer::Hlg.is_hlg());
assert!(!ColorTransfer::Pq.is_hlg());
Source

pub const fn is_pq(&self) -> bool

Returns true if this is Perceptual Quantizer / SMPTE ST 2084 (PQ).

§Examples
use ff_format::color::ColorTransfer;

assert!(ColorTransfer::Pq.is_pq());
assert!(!ColorTransfer::Hlg.is_pq());
Source

pub const fn is_unknown(&self) -> bool

Returns true if the transfer characteristic is unknown.

§Examples
use ff_format::color::ColorTransfer;

assert!(ColorTransfer::Unknown.is_unknown());
assert!(!ColorTransfer::Bt709.is_unknown());
